Abstract
N-Carboxymethylchitosan from crab and shrimp chitosans was obtained in water-soluble form by proper selection of the reactant ratio, i.e. using equimolar quantities of glyoxylic acid and amino groups. HPLC determinations of glyoxylic and glycolic acids, in conjunction with NMR analysis, permitted identification of the structure of the product, which is partly N-mono-carboxymethylated (0.3), N,N-dicarboxymethylated (0.3) and N-acetylated depending on the level of deacetylation of the starting chitosan (0.08-0.15). The preparation can be made successfully even in the presence of large concentrations of glycolic acid. The use of enzymes exerting hydrolysing activity on the high-molecular-weight fractions helps to avoid gel formation during storage and precipitate formation on addition of anti-microbial agents.Entities:
